عَجَائِب is how you say “wonders” in Arabic. Hear it pronounced and see it used in a real example sentence from classical texts below.
والتفكر في عجائبه والعمل بمحكمه والتسليم بمتشابهه
And contemplate its wonders, act on its clear commandments, and submit to its ambiguous ones.
عَجَائِبِهِ — its wonders. A broken plural, 'wonders / marvels,' owned by the Book, in the -i form after 'in.' These are what the reflection contemplates — the astonishing features of the text.
